CPU Frequency Selector features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    The Cinnamon CPU Frequency Selector applet provides a user-friendly interface for managing CPU frequency, making it accessible for users who prefer a GUI over command-line tools.
  • Fine-Grained Control
    It allows users to manually set the CPU frequency or choose between different governors, giving fine-grained control over performance and power consumption.
  • Integration with Cinnamon
    The applet integrates seamlessly with the Cinnamon desktop environment, offering a consistent user experience and an aesthetic that's familiar to Cinnamon users.
  • Open Source
    Being open-source, the applet is free to use, and users can modify it to fit their needs or contribute to its development.
  • Real-Time Information
    Users can view real-time information about CPU frequency and governor status directly from the applet, helping them make informed decisions about their CPU's performance.

Possible disadvantages of CPU Frequency Selector

  • Limited to Cinnamon
    The applet is specifically designed for the Cinnamon desktop environment, which limits its usability for those using other desktop environments.
  • Potential Stability Issues
    As with any software that alters system settings, there is a potential risk of stability issues or system crashes if not used properly.
  • Dependency on System Compatibility
    The effectiveness and functionality of the applet can depend on the compatibility of the underlying hardware and kernel with CPU frequency scaling.
  • Learning Curve for New Users
    Users unfamiliar with CPU frequency scaling and governors might face a learning curve in understanding how to optimally use the applet.
  • Possible Overhead
    While generally lightweight, running additional applets can add a slight overhead to system resources, which might be a consideration for users on low-resource systems.

MemoWidget features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    MemoWidget features a simple and int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to create and manage their notes and reminders. Its design minimizes the learning curve for new users.
  • Customizable Appearance
    The application allows users to customize the appearance of widgets, enabling them to personalize their experience and integrate the app seamlessly with their device's home screen.
  • Feature-Rich
    Includes a variety of features such as reminders, note organization, and calendar integration, providing users with a comprehensive tool for managing their tasks and schedules.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    MemoWidget supports multiple platforms, allowing users to access their notes and reminders on Android and potentially other operating systems in the future.

Possible disadvantages of MemoWidget

  • Limited Free Version
    The free version of MemoWidget may have limitations on certain features or the number of widgets that can be used, prompting users to purchase the premium version for full functionality.
  • Device Compatibility Issues
    Some users might experience compatibility issues on older devices or less common operating systems, which might hinder the app's functionality and performance.
  • Potential Privacy Concerns
    As with any app that requires personal data, there may be concerns about data privacy and security, especially if the app requests access to sensitive information.
  •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    While the basic interface is user-friendly, some advanced features might require a bit more time to understand and utilize effectively, particularly for less tech-savvy users.
